#76616e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76616e is composed of 46.3% red, 38%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#76616e color hex could be obtained by blending #ecc2d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#76616e color description : Dark grayish pink.
#76616e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#76616e has RGB values of R:118, G:97,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.07,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7758190.

Shades and Tints of #76616e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a090a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
